The DIY Auto Transport Approach

DIY auto transport involves renting equipment and operating the transport yourself to your destination. This option appeals to many people who seek cost reduction.

Obtaining transport equipment read more from a local equipment rental company typically costs between $500-$1,500 for a one-way trip, depending on distance and hauling requirements. You'll also need to consider gasoline spending, toll road fees, and hotel costs for extended trips.

The DIY vehicle transport method requires considerable manual labor, mechanical knowledge, and personal time investment. You're also personally liable for any damage that occurs during transport.

FAQs: DIY vs Professional Car Transport

Q: How much does professional auto transport typically cost?

A: Expert shipping typically ranges from $1,000-$5,000+ depending on travel distance, car specifications, and transport method. Get detailed quotes on professional car transport to understand your specific costs.

Q: Is independent car shipping really cheaper than commercial options?

A: Not always. When you account for all fees, including equipment rental, gas, tolls, and potential damage, expert shipping often proves equally affordable.

Q: What happens if my vehicle is damaged during DIY auto transport?

A: You're personally responsible. With commercial transport, the copyright's insurance coverage protects you.

Q: How long does professional car transport take?

A: Most car moving takes 2-7 days depending on distance and route. Learn more about professional vehicle transport timelines to plan accordingly.
